Understanding Bearing Thrust Key Concepts and Applications Bearing thrust is an essential concept in engineering, particularly in the design and operation of machinery that involves rotating components. It plays a crucial role in ensuring the efficiency and longevity of various mechanical systems. This article aims to explore the nature of bearing thrust, its causes, implications, and solutions for effective engineering practice. At its core, bearing thrust refers to the axial load that is exerted on bearings as they support and facilitate the rotation of shafts and other elements within a machine . This axial loading can occur due to various factors, including the weight of the rotating components, external forces acting on the system, or changes in operational dynamics. Understanding the sources and magnitudes of these loads is critical for engineers, as improper management can lead to premature wear or catastrophic failure of bearings. One primary consideration in bearing thrust is the type of bearing being utilized. There are various bearing types, such as ball bearings, roller bearings, and thrust bearings, each designed to handle specific loading conditions. Thrust bearings, for instance, are particularly well-suited for managing axial loads, making them ideal for applications where significant thrust forces are present. Selecting the appropriate bearing type based on the anticipated thrust load is vital to the integrity of the mechanical system. bearing thrust Bearing thrust affects not only the bearings themselves but also the entire machinery setup. Excessive thrust can lead to misalignment, increased friction, excessive heat generation, and, ultimately, failure. Therefore, raceway design and lubrication become paramount in mitigating thrust-related issues. Proper lubrication helps reduce friction and wear while facilitating heat dissipation, ensuring smooth operation and extending the life of the bearings. In engineering applications, calculating the expected bearing thrust is crucial. Engineers typically employ formulas that consider the mass of rotating components, their speed, and the nature of the loads acting on them. This calculation informs the design process, helping engineers choose bearings with adequate load ratings and materials that withstand operational demands. Moreover, it is essential to monitor bearing performance regularly. Technologies such as vibration analysis and temperature monitoring can provide insights into bearing health and help detect unusual patterns typically associated with thrust-related problems. Early detection allows for preventive maintenance, minimizing downtime and enhancing operational reliability. In summary, bearing thrust is a key consideration in the design and maintenance of rotating machinery. Understanding its implications and effectively managing it through appropriate bearing selection, design, lubrication, and regular monitoring is critical for ensuring the longevity and reliability of mechanical systems. As industries continue to evolve, the importance of managing thrust loads in bearings remains a foundational aspect of engineering that cannot be overlooked. By staying vigilant and informed, engineers can help mitigate the risks associated with bearing thrust, ultimately contributing to efficient and sustainable machinery operation.
